Abstract:
Background: Kakadu plum extract, also called as Terminalia Ferdinandiana which has an antioxidant effect, anti wrinkles and skin lightening effect. However, the hypopigmenting effect of Kakadu plum extract in human subjects has only been shown in a few studies.
Objective: The aim of this study was to investigate the efficacy and safety of Kakadu plum extract cream in comparison with placebo cream in the treatment of dark spots or uneven hyperpigmentation.
Materials and methods: Thirty patients (men and women, aged 20-55 years old) with dark spots or uneven hyperpigmentation were enrolled to this randomized, split face comparative study. The patients were enrolled and randomly assigned Kakadu plum extract on one side and placebo on the other side twice daily for 8 weeks with follow up every 4 weeks. Mexameter measurement were perfomed along with photography by VISIA Analysis at baseline, 4th week, 8th week and 12th week. Adverse events and satisfaction score were observed and recorded throughout the study.
Results: All the patients completed the study. The subjects were male (5/30, 16.67%) and female (25/30, 83.34%). The average patients age was 35.47±9.52. The average male age was 34.2±13.99. The average female age was 35.72±8.74. All patients showed pigment improvement with both treatments. The result revealed the mean melanin index of Kakadu plum extract before treatment was 269.56±70.29, while after treatment the mean melanin index became 240.19±61.57. The result of the placebo cream before treatment was 245.49±73.12, while after treatment changed 220.41±66.07. No statistical significant difference (p-value=0.24). There is no serious side effects of these both creams. The participant satisfaction rated mostly at mildly satisfied for both Kakadu plum extract cream and placebo with no shown of significant difference between both sides.
Conclusions: No significant improved of dark spots and uneven hyperpigmentation between Kakadu plum compared with placebo
